Additional Product information: Devices for measuring the oxygen saturation of haemoglobin in arterial blood (SpO2). They use the principle of differential light absorption to determine SpO2 when the sensor (also called a probe) is applied to an area of the body (e.g. a finger, toe or earlobe). Monitoring stations used for the continuous monitoring of multiple vital signs.

In 2021, Top exporters of Pulse oximeters; Multiparametric Patient Monitoring devices to Aruba were European Union ($301.26K ), Germany ($248.09K ), United States ($71.12K , 65 Item), Netherlands ($49.85K ), Italy ($1.74K ).
